natural language
n : a human written or spoken language used by a community;
opposed to e.g. a computer language [syn: tongue] [ant:
artificial language]

natural language
A language spoken or written by humans, as
opposed to a language use to program or communicate with
computers. Natural language understanding is one of the
hardest problems of artificial intelligence due to the
complexity, irregularity and diversity of human language and
the philosophical problems of meaning.
